What is eating my seedlings at night?

There are several possibilities for the damage you see, most likely either snails, slugs, earwigs or birds. Soil and plant moisture levels from all the rain we've had right now favor the likelihood of snail, slug or earwig. These pests are night feeders.

What is the best way to protect seedlings?

Drape clear plastic or garden fleece over recently sown blocks or rows of young seedlings. Individual plants can be protected with squares of plastic or fleece cut to size, or by using purpose-sold cloches. Alternatively, make your own from clear plastic drinks bottles.

How do I get rid of bugs on my seedlings?

Insecticidal soap Simply put 1/4 cup vegetable oil and 1 tbsp liquid dish soap ($9)—it must be free of bleach, degreaser, synthetic dyes, and fragrances—in a spray bottle ($8), then fill it to the top with warm water, and shake. You can spray the mixture onto your plants once a week in order to combat pest issues.

What can I spray on sunflowers for bugs?

A basic dish soap and water insecticidal spray is helpful for killing sunflower moths and keeping them away from your plants. Simply mix 1 1/2 teaspoons of any type of dish soap with 1 quart of water. Pour this mixture into a spray bottle, and spray directly on to your sunflowers.

How do I stop rats from eating my seedlings?

Rats will often mow down tender seedlings. To prevent this, you can construct simple coils out of chicken wire to go over the top & protect your seedlings until they get large enough to be unpalatable. Remember that rats dig, so the coils will need to be sunk into the earth as you put in the seedlings.
